Transaction cfc76dae716fc1dd51efa62fbec309990c5b09df70ca100100f0f0b6da0c43f1
2 Input
2 Outputs
- cfc76dae716fc1dd51efa62fbec309990c5b09df70ca100100f0f0b6da0c43f1:0
- cfc76dae716fc1dd51efa62fbec309990c5b09df70ca100100f0f0b6da0c43f1:1
value 154396
address 348jUfrtxKdDLWK1um9Fi691AL4c3LV1Hf
value 674
address 1LSFcA5eZjMTwTnMHPe1J4sTE2uJfrfR77